Hi TalkTalk,

 

Hopefully you can help...

 

In March 2024 I updated my iPhone XR to an iPhone 15, since then my new iPhone keeps intermittently reporting "no internet connection" despite a full WiFi signal. A reboot of the router or the handset resolves the issue until it occurs again. All other devices connected via Wi-Fi continue to function as normal.

 

This is at both my own and my mums house that have the same model Sagemcom WiFi Hub.

 

At both locations with the Sagemcom WiFi Hub my car (Volvo AAOS) will not connect to the WiFi despite a strong signal.

 

My brother also has TalkTalk Internet but with Amazon Eero, my car connects fine there, and my iPhone's WiFi functions as expected, no intermittent reporting of "no internet connection".

 

Aside from buying an OpenReach VDSL2 modem and a set of Amazon Eero, are there any other options available to me?

 

iPhone is on IOS 17.5.1 but this issue existed with previous iOS versions since brought in March 2024. I've also disabled "Private WiFi Address" within iOS at locations with the Sagemcom router in case it was upsetting things. 

 

Volvo AAOS has recently had a big update from AAOS 11 to AAOS 12 and the issue persists.

 

Both Sagemcom Routers are on the latest version of Firmware.

 

Can you suggest a "next move" please?
